首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Powershell修改CSV

Powershell是一种用于自动化任务和配置管理的脚本语言,它在Windows操作系统中广泛使用。Powershell可以通过命令行界面或脚本文件来执行各种操作,包括修改CSV文件。

CSV(Comma-Separated Values)是一种常见的文件格式,用于存储和交换以逗号分隔的数据。Powershell提供了一些内置的命令和功能,可以方便地读取、修改和保存CSV文件。

要修改CSV文件,可以使用以下步骤:

  1. 导入CSV文件:使用Import-Csv命令将CSV文件加载到Powershell中的一个变量中。例如,假设CSV文件名为data.csv,可以使用以下命令导入文件:
代码语言:txt
复制
$data = Import-Csv -Path "data.csv"
  1. 修改CSV数据:通过访问变量中的属性,可以对CSV文件中的数据进行修改。例如,假设CSV文件包含"Name"和"Age"两列,可以使用以下命令修改"Age"列的数值:
代码语言:txt
复制
$data | ForEach-Object { $_.Age = $_.Age + 1 }
  1. 保存修改后的CSV文件:使用Export-Csv命令将修改后的数据保存到新的CSV文件中。例如,假设要保存到新文件new_data.csv,可以使用以下命令:
代码语言:txt
复制
$data | Export-Csv -Path "new_data.csv" -NoTypeInformation

在云计算领域,Powershell可以与各种云服务提供商的API进行集成,实现自动化管理和配置。腾讯云提供了一系列与Powershell集成的产品和服务,例如:

  • 腾讯云对象存储(COS):用于存储和管理大规模数据的云存储服务。可以使用Powershell脚本通过COS API上传、下载、删除文件等操作。
  • 腾讯云云服务器(CVM):提供可扩展的虚拟服务器,用于部署应用程序和托管网站。可以使用Powershell脚本通过CVM API创建、启动、停止、删除虚拟机等操作。
  • 腾讯云数据库(TencentDB):提供高性能、可扩展的数据库服务。可以使用Powershell脚本通过TencentDB API创建、管理、备份数据库等操作。
  • 腾讯云人工智能(AI):提供各种人工智能服务,如图像识别、语音识别、自然语言处理等。可以使用Powershell脚本通过AI API调用这些服务。

以上是一些腾讯云的产品和服务示例,可以与Powershell结合使用。当然,还有更多的产品和服务可以根据具体需求进行选择和使用。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

使用PowerShell管理和修改Windows域密码策略

本文将介绍如何使用PowerShell查看和修改Windows域的密码策略。...首先,我们需要在已连接到Active Directory的主机上运行PowerShell,以管理员身份打开,然后加载Active Directory模块: Import-Module ActiveDirectory...有时,我们可能需要修改这些密码策略。...因此,在修改密码策略时,一定要权衡安全性和实用性。 最后,修改了组策略后,我们通常需要刷新策略,使其立即生效。...总结,使用PowerShell管理和修改Windows域的密码策略是一项强大的功能,可以帮助我们更好地控制组织的安全性。然而,修改密码策略时一定要谨慎,因为不恰当的设置可能会导致系统安全性降低。

1.2K30

PowerShell命令行修改DNS服务器设置

幸运的是,PowerShell提供了一种更快捷的方法,让你可以通过命令行修改DNS服务器设置。本文将详细介绍如何使用PowerShell命令行修改DNS服务器设置。...使用PowerShell修改DNS服务器设置 在Windows系统中,你可以使用PowerShell的 Set-DnsClientServerAddress 命令修改DNS服务器设置。...你可以从这个列表中找出你需要修改的网络接口的名称。 在修改了DNS服务器设置之后,你可能想要确认修改已经生效。...虽可以通过图形界面进行这项任务,但是PowerShell提供了一种更快捷的方法。...希望你发现本文有用,并学到了一些新的PowerShell技巧!如果你有任何问题或需要更深入的解释,欢迎在评论区留言。

1.5K20

Windows:通过PowerShell实现普通用户修改自身密码

今天,我们将探讨如何使用PowerShell脚本实现Windows普通用户修改自身密码。 场景概述 让普通用户通过脚本更改自己的密码可能是自动化管理或特殊用途的重要部分。...尽管系统提供了图形界面进行密码修改,但有时可能需要通过编程方式来实现。在本文中,我们将详细介绍如何使用PowerShell脚本来实现这一目标。...脚本解释 下面是实现该功能的PowerShell脚本: Add-Type -AssemblyName System.DirectoryServices.AccountManagement $principalContext...总结 此PowerShell脚本提供了一种快捷的方式,允许Windows普通用户修改自己的密码。这可以成为自动化任务、批量操作或特殊管理需求的有力工具。...希望这篇博文能帮助你更好地理解如何通过PowerShell实现Windows普通用户修改自身密码。这一技能可能成为系统管理和自动化工具箱中的有用组成部分。

84010

PowerShell系列(七)PowerShell当中的Provider介绍

今天给大家讲解PowerShell当中的非常重要的概念Provider相关的知识,希望对大家能有所帮助!...1、Provider概念介绍 PowerShell Provider是基于NetFrameWork运行的一个框架,它的作用是让数据(文件、注册表环境对象等等)以特殊的方式保存在PowerShell里面,...在PowerShell中,可以使用PSDrive来操作系统中的驱动器。...● 注册表:可以在PowerShell环境高效操作注册表对象● 功能函数:构建在PowerShell环境当中,可以调用的功能函数。● 证书:在证书存储中存储的证书对象,包含用户和计算机证书信息。...● 变量:在PowerShell中的变量和相关参数的获取。● WSMan:PowerShell应用的Web Service管理对象。

31641

CSV文件编辑器——Modern CSV for mac

在编辑 CSV 文档时,大多数人都在寻找一种高度专业的工具来帮助他们做他们想做或实际需要做的任何事情。现代 CSV 正是这种类型的工具。它提供了大量的选项和功能,同时快速且易于使用。...考虑到这一点,当涉及到 CSV 文档时,这个小程序可以做正确的事情。 点击安装》Modern CSV for mac 快速编辑 多单元格编辑 复制行、列和单元格。 移动行、列和单元格。...Modern CSV Mac功能特点 轻松编辑CSV文件 为什么移动列、复制行或拆分单元格会很困难?使用现代 CSV,这很容易。 使用大多数命令,您可以一次对多个行、列或单元格进行操作。...快速查看大型 CSV 文件 Modern CSV 不仅是一个强大的 CSV 编辑器,还是一个强大的 CSV 查看器。它带有只读模式,可以快速加载大文件,并且占用的内存很小,只是文件大小的一小部分。...您可以自定义的 CSV 编辑器 我们将 Modern CSV 设计为一个易于使用的应用程序。要更轻松地查看 CSV 文件,您可以设置主题(浅色或深色)、更改单元格大小或每隔一行或一列添加阴影。

4.6K30
领券